HSPRS Regional Case Manager

Holy Family Institute
11.2024 - Current
  • Maintained accurate documentation on all cases, ensuring compliance with regulations and confidentiality requirements.
  • Monitored ongoing cases closely, adjusting case management strategies as needed based on evolving circumstances or new information.
  • Educated clients on available programs, benefits, and services, empowering them to make informed decisions about their care needs.
  • Conducting Home Studies: Assessing the safety and suitability of a sponsor before an unaccompanied child is released from custody.
  • Developing Service Plans: Creating individualized plans that address the needs of children and sponsors, utilizing a range of services and resources.
  • Conducting Assessments: Performing comprehensive assessments to provide recommendations for reunifying children with potential sponsors.
  • Crisis Intervention: Providing support in crisis situations, including involving Child Protective Services, law enforcement, and other local stakeholders when necessary
